About Lima (LIM)

Overlooking the Pacific Ocean and laying on the desert coast, Lima is the capital and the largest city of Peru. This beautiful city is nestled in thew valleys of Chillon, Rimac and Lurin Rivers. The history of this place traces back to pre-Columbian era. Mounted at an elevation of 1,600ft above the mean sea level, the land comprises clusters of isolated hills. Despite its location in the tropics and desert, Lima has a climate that is pleasantly mild. Lima abounds with structures that were built during 16th, 17th and further centuries. Raised in 16th century, Iglesia de Santo Domingo and its monasteries are beautiful masterpieces. Casa Aliaga and Santuario de Santa Rosa de Lima are two magnificent structures built during 5th and 17th centuries respectively. Then there are two historical mansions, Casa de la Riva and Casa Pilatos, which feature wooden balconies, elegant patio and antique furnishing. The land has one important archaeological site, Pachacamac; this is a pre-Columbian citadel built around AD 100. Other one is Huaca Huallamarca that dates to AD 200 to AD 500. Lima has a large number of museums, each one of them featuring distinct style of building, unique patterning, dating to different centuries. Decorated with subtle carving, ceramic insertions, ornate ceilings, complex weaving, and so much more the structures make the visitors spellbound. Cast a look at Museo Rafael Larco Herrea, Museo Nacional de Antropologia, Museo Taurino, Museo de Historia Natural and Convento de Los Descalzos. Apart from historical, there are numerous galleries that display art by contemporary artists, academics, collection of artifacts and mosaics. Visit Museo de Arte de Lima, Museo de Arte Italiano and cAsa de Riva Aguero. The city offers to the visitors so many options for entertainments. There are bars, live music centres, clubs, pubs, beer halls, chillouts, cinema and gay or lesbian counters. Cast in different theme, decorated with artistic decor, the bars and clubs dish out the lip smacking food and delicious drinks. Juanito's, Tai Lounge, Media Naranja, Wahios, Tequila Rocks, Teatriz and Senor Frogs are few favored places. Lima is also a great place to go on shopping spree. About Bogota (BOG)

The capital city of Colombia, Bogota is located in the centre of the country. The city has a varied nightlife and offers domestic as well as foreign tourists different options and unique styles. It is a city of contrasts as it offers a unique experience to its visitors. Bogota has earned a prominent place among the prime gastronomic capitals of Latin America. You can easily find six dining areas in world-class restaurants which offer local and international cuisines. Travellers can easily find numerous accommodation options. More than 300 hotels of both national as well as internationals chains make Bogotá the main destination of foreign tourists coming from all across the globe. Its venues for business, events and conventions combine it as one of the favourite and an ideal tourist destination for executives globally. The city is a permanent cultural agenda that is reflected in its more than 60 museums and famous art galleries. The city is renowned for its most important Iberoamerican theatre festival in the world. It has 29 religious temples which are part of its heritage, 4,500 parks and over 50 shopping malls and outlets where you can purchase the latest trendy as well as fashionable outfits and other stuff created by haute couture Colombian designers. The city was declared as one of the 31 famous destinations to visit in the year 2010 by the distinguished New York Times. It is an exhilarating city with millions of astonishing stories that guide visitors every day. Monserrate Sanctuary, Atlantis Plaza Mall, featuring the Hard Rock Cafe, Casa de la Moneda (Colombian Mint), La Candelaria (The Historical District), Colon Theater, Maloka and many others are some of the famous tourist attractions that magnetize large number of travellers every year from all across the world.
